Crucial Considerations Before Investing in an External SSD

The modern digital landscape demands efficient storage solutions, and external SSDs have emerged as the champions for speed, portability, and reliability. People seek these devices to overcome the limitations of internal storage, facilitate quick data transfers between devices, or create portable work environments. They’re indispensable for anyone dealing with large files – be it photographers, videographers, graphic designers, gamers, or professionals requiring secure, on-the-go access to their data.

The ideal customer for an external SSD is someone who values speed above all else, frequently moves large files, or needs a robust backup solution that can withstand bumps and jostles. They might be a content creator editing 4K footage on the go, a student needing to carry vast lecture notes and software, or a business professional requiring secure client data at their fingertips.

Conversely, those who primarily need archival storage for small, static files and rarely move their drive might find an external HDD a more cost-effective choice, as they offer significantly more storage per dollar, albeit at a fraction of the speed and with greater susceptibility to physical shock.

Before making a purchase, consider the following:
* Capacity: How much storage do you genuinely need? 1TB, 2TB, or more?
* Speed: Does your workflow demand blazing-fast read/write speeds, or are moderate speeds sufficient? Check the USB standard (e.g., USB 3.2 Gen 2).
* Portability & Durability: Will you be carrying it frequently? Look for compact, robust designs.
* Security: Is data encryption important for your sensitive files?
* Compatibility: Ensure it works seamlessly with your devices (Windows, Mac, Android, etc.) and offers the necessary cable types.
* Price: SSDs are more expensive than HDDs; balance your budget with your performance needs.

Introducing the Samsung T7 Portable SSD

The Samsung T7 Portable SSD – 1 TB in Titanium Grey (MU-PC1T0T/WW) is a compact and powerful external solid-state drive designed to deliver lightning-fast data transfer speeds in a sleek, portable package. It promises to revolutionize your workflow by dramatically reducing load and transfer times, making it ideal for professionals and enthusiasts alike. Out of the box, you get the T7 Portable SSD itself, along with two essential cables: a USB-C to USB-C cable and a USB-C to USB-A cable, ensuring broad compatibility with both modern and older devices.

Compared to its predecessor, the T5, the T7 boasts significantly higher read/write speeds, leveraging USB 3.2 Gen 2 for near double the performance. While market leaders might offer similar speeds, Samsung often distinguishes itself with its robust software suite, hardware encryption, and reputation for reliability. This specific 1 TB model is perfect for creative professionals, gamers, or anyone needing substantial, fast storage that fits in a pocket, offering a sweet spot between capacity and portability. It might not be for someone who needs multi-terabyte archival storage on a tight budget, where traditional hard drives still offer a lower cost per gigabyte.

Here’s a quick look at its strengths and weaknesses:

Pros:
* Blazing-fast speeds: Up to 1,050 MB/s read and 1,000 MB/s write.
* Extremely compact and lightweight: Fits easily in any pocket or bag.
* Robust metal casing: Enhances durability and heat dissipation.
* Hardware encryption: AES 256-bit protection for sensitive data.
* Wide compatibility: Works with Windows, Mac, and Android devices.

Cons:
* Paint/finish can scratch easily: Some users report cosmetic wear quickly.
* No included protective case: A small pouch would greatly enhance durability.
* Gets warm under heavy load: Though within acceptable limits, it can be noticeable.
* Encryption software dependency: Requires the Samsung app for unlocking on some devices.
* Performance variability: Highly dependent on the host device’s USB port capabilities.

Exceptional Speed and Connectivity

One of the most compelling aspects of the Samsung T7 Portable SSD is its incredible speed. Rated for sequential read speeds of up to 1,050 MB/s and write speeds of up to 1,000 MB/s, it leverages the power of USB 3.2 Gen.2 (also known as USB 3.1 Gen 2). This translates to genuinely rapid data transfers. In real-world usage, copying large files – say, a 15 GB video project – can be done in mere seconds, not minutes. This is crucial for anyone involved in video editing, high-resolution photography, or large software installations, where every second saved contributes to a more fluid workflow.

For instance, I’ve used this external SSD extensively for 4K video editing directly from the drive, even when it’s almost full, and it handles the workload with remarkable ease. The difference compared to a traditional hard drive is night and day; no more stuttering playback or frustrating export times. This speed isn’t just about raw numbers; it’s about enabling creative freedom and minimizing interruptions. Even with sustained heavy usage, while some users mention a slight speed drop (around 5-6%) when the drive gets warm, the performance remains robust enough for demanding tasks. It truly shines when connected to a compatible USB-C port (like Thunderbolt 3 on a MacBook Pro), where its full potential is unleashed, with file copying speeds mirroring the theoretical benchmarks.

Unmatched Portability and Durable Design

Measuring at just 3.35″L x 2.24″W x 0.31″Th and weighing a mere 58 grams, the T7 Portable SSD is incredibly compact and lightweight. It’s roughly the size of a credit card and about as thick as four stacked cards, making it effortlessly fit into any pocket, small bag, or even a wallet. The sleek Titanium Grey metal body not only looks premium but also contributes significantly to its durability and heat dissipation.

The metal enclosure, as I’ve observed, helps radiate heat away from the internal components, which is crucial for maintaining performance and extending the drive’s lifespan during intensive use. While some users note that the paint can scratch relatively easily without a protective pouch (a common minor complaint), the underlying robust construction ensures that it can withstand minor drops and impacts far better than traditional spinning hard drives. This portability means I can take all my critical files and even applications with me, setting up my workspace wherever I go, without worrying about fragility. It’s an ideal companion for travel, fieldwork, or simply moving between different workstations at home or the office.

Advanced Security Features

Data security is paramount, and the Samsung T7 Portable SSD addresses this with built-in hardware encryption. It features AES 256-bit hardware encryption, which means your data is secured at the hardware level, making it incredibly difficult for unauthorized individuals to access your files. Coupled with password protection, you have a robust defense against data theft or loss.

The encryption is managed through the intuitive Samsung Portable SSD software, which is available for Windows, macOS, and Android. This allows for easy setup and management of your password. However, it’s worth noting that using this software means other devices (like Smart TVs or routers) might not be able to access the encrypted drive unless they also have the software installed, which can be a minor inconvenience for specific use cases. For anyone dealing with sensitive client information, personal financial records, or confidential project details, this hardware encryption provides peace of mind, knowing that your data is safe even if the drive falls into the wrong hands.

Broad Compatibility and Thoughtful Inclusions

The Samsung T7 Portable SSD demonstrates excellent compatibility across a range of devices, including desktops and laptops running Windows and macOS. Crucially, it also works seamlessly with modern Android devices and even iPad Pro models, expanding its utility significantly.

The inclusion of both a USB-C to USB-C cable and a USB-C to USB-A cable right in the box is a thoughtful addition. This ensures that whether your device has the latest USB-C ports or older USB-A ports, you’re ready to connect immediately without needing to purchase additional adapters or cables. While some users mention the included cables can be a bit thick or stiff, they are robust and rated for the high speeds the drive is capable of. This broad compatibility makes the T7 an incredibly versatile tool, allowing you to use it with almost any modern computing device without hassle.

Optimized Performance and Longevity

Beyond raw speed, the T7 also incorporates intelligent features to optimize performance and enhance longevity. For instance, the drive has a built-in mechanism that intelligently cuts off read and write operations after about 30 seconds of inactivity, indicated by a light. This not only conserves power but also significantly contributes to the drive’s lifespan by reducing unnecessary wear and tear.

The solid-state nature of the drive, combined with its metallic casing, contributes to its overall longevity. Unlike traditional HDDs with moving parts, SSDs are inherently more resistant to shock and vibration, which are common causes of failure for portable storage. The intelligent thermal management, where the aluminum body dissipates heat, helps keep the internal chips at optimal operating temperatures, further extending their working life. While heavy sustained use can make it warm, it rarely becomes ‘hot’ to the point of concern, maintaining stable performance even during prolonged transfers or editing sessions.

What Users Are Saying: Real-World Experiences

I scoured the internet and found numerous user reviews that consistently echoed my own positive experiences, with some valuable insights into minor drawbacks. Many users praised its compact size, robust build, and excellent finish, noting its perfect compatibility with MacBooks and Windows PCs. The speed was a recurring highlight, with users reporting excellent performance for demanding tasks like 4K video editing, running virtual machines, and gaming, often achieving speeds between 700-750 Mbps. Its small footprint and lightweight design were also frequently lauded for making it an ideal travel companion. However, several users pointed out that the drive’s aesthetic, while appealing, is prone to scratches, and expressed a common desire for an included protective case. Some also observed that the drive can get noticeably warm with continuous, heavy usage, and that its full speed potential is highly dependent on the host device’s USB port capabilities.
